For example, the company doesn’t have enough resources to support a Scrum environment, or the team finds Scrum’s requirements too rigid. Get going with our crush course for beginners and create your first project. LogRocket identifies friction points in the user experience so you can make informed decisions about product and design changes that must happen to hit your goals.
We can use our inter-process buffers and flow diagrams to show us our process weaknesses and opportunities for kaizen. As we get closer to level production, we will start to become less concerned with burndown and more concerned with cycle time, as one is the effect and the other is the cause. Average lead time and cycle time will become the primary focus of performance. If cycle time is under control and the team capacity is balanced against demand, then lead time will also be under control. If cycle time is under control, then burndowns are predictable and uninteresting.
What Are the Benefits of Scrumban?
You will need to establish a limit on how much work your team can take on at any one point. For Scrumban, that limit will be the number of total cards on the board at any time. Set a realistic limit to keep your team from becoming overwhelmed and frustrated. The scrum system does nothing to fix this; rather the product owner simply continues to select the most important items, and the team goes and does them. In the world of project management, there is constant evolution and transformation of one methodology into another. The combination of traditional and agile methodologies has given rise to the hybrid model of project management.
To keep iterations short, WIP limits are used, and a planning trigger is set to know when to plan next – when WIP falls below a predetermined level. There are no predefined roles in Scrumban; the team keeps the roles they already have. Because scrumban is a hybrid agile development framework for working on projects, scrumban methodology the tools project managers and teams use need to share that flexibility. ProjectManager is a cloud-based project management software that can work in any project management methodology. Whether you’re managing your project in waterfall, an agile framework or a hybrid, our features are plastic to pivot with you.
Enterprise Kanban for Scaling Agile Teams: 5 Benefits of Expanding Kanban Across Teams for Your Agile Transformation
Once your list has been prioritized, you must specify what needs to be done for each item on the list. So it will help easily take up the work items and begin working on them whenever the team comes together for a planning session. In a word, Scrum is an Agile approach that is straightforward and iterative and splits a project into smaller, more manageable tasks. Scrum introduces the idea of sprints, which are set aside times when the team members concentrate only on the current task at hand.
- For many software development teams, an immediate shift to Kanban would be too drastic.
- I am passionate about solving business problems by bringing the team together and removing impediments.
- The biggest wins are in delivering a higher quality product, achieving continuous improvement, minimizing waste, and reducing lead time.
- In a one-year bucket, you’ll only find vague ideas without any details on their requirements or how they’ll be manifested.
- The methodology of Scrumban is best suited for modern projects having multidisciplinary requirements.
- A good team leader will assess the types of projects a company has and the unique goals, team experience, readiness, timing, and other factors.
- If we let the person who is best at performing the specify function handle more of that work, then we may also need to coordinate handoffs between ourselves.
Breaking up our nebulous in-process state into better-defined states can give everybody more visibility into the strengths, weaknesses, and overall health of the team. The team responds to the pull event and selects the next priority item to go into the ready queue. Scrumban is a pull system, meaning that it produces work when the next stage requests it. This entails eliminating some practices in scrum, most significantly regular sprint planning sessions.
The fast-paced procedure enables quick and relatively risk-free concept testing. Be sure to not create more than a few columns so as not to overcomplicate the process. Team members move the cards from column to column as they complete each step towards completion. Compared to other methodologies, Scrumban is new and untested.
Each of these sprints lasts about 2-4 weeks and allows you to work on separate sections of the project individually. With an approaching project deadline, the project manager decides which of the in-development features will be completed and which will stay unfinished. https://globalcloudteam.com/ This guarantees that the team can focus on finishing important features before the project deadline and forget the less important ones. This ensures that a team can easily adapt and change their course of action to a quickly changing environment.
Using clearly stated policies about the way work gets done to ensure that all of your employees understand their roles and how they fit into project and company-wide goals. Your teams can gain greater clarity on how to apply Scrum Guide concepts in practice, without replacing them. When a company wants to give its team more flexibility in how it works.
And scrumban would certainly fall under the umbrella of hybridized agile. Let’s look specifically at a few disadvantages to utilizing scrumban. Blending agile methodologies, generally speaking, is not considered a good thing.
Perhaps most importantly, remember that Scrumban’s embedded principles and practices are not unique to the software development process. They can be easily applied in many different contexts, providing a common language and shared experience between interrelated business functions. The Service Level Expectations chart is a forecasting chart and number dashboard that your Scrumban team should attach to or include with your Scrumban board. This chart tells everyone how much time is forecast to complete the work and helps to set expectations.
Now, let’s take a look at some of the drawbacks of using the Scrumban methodology:
Teams decide what tasks they will pay more attention to during the planning event. This means that the ‘To Do’ list will specify what tasks need to be done first and which ones can be done later. Scrumban can also be used as a steppingstone from Scrum to Kanban.
These are mini scrum sprints, and are kept short so the team can easily make changes to their work if they need to. Iterations are measured in weeks and typically kept below two. In Scrumban tasks are not assigned to the team members by the team leader or project manager. Each team member chooses which task from the To Do section they are going to complete next.
Your Guide to Successful Freelance Project Management
A lean workflow only spends time doing something that adds value to the final product. It carefully maps out a value-stream in the work process, ensuring that every step is useful and no actions are wasted energy. Ladas sought to remedy what he saw as errors in the scrum framework, in part by combining it with the kanban workflow system, which is closely related to the theory of constraints. Perhaps let us begin with a few things that Scrumban rejected from Scrum.
When a company is ready to start implementing the plan, the requirements are moved into the 3-month bucket and divided into clear tasks to be completed by the project team. It is from this bucket that the team draws tasks during their on-demand planning meeting and starts working on the tasks. We have kanban boards that have easy-to-use drag and drop cards and customizable columns that allow you to organize your work your way. Teams are given collaborative scrumban tools to work more effectively.
Wave Accounting Review: App Features, Pricing, Pros & Cons
WIP limits are meant to keep team members focused on a limited number of tasks and ensure meaningful progress toward completing them. When the team is overwhelmed with simultaneously ongoing tasks, productivity suffers. Scrumban’s rules and guidelines are simple so they can be adopted in any industry. The visual board helps the team stay on track and the deadline-free environment enables it to be flexible and adapt to changing requirements. Scrum revolves around a set of scrum ceremonies, including sprint planning, daily scrum, sprint review, retrospective, and backlog refinement.
The supply of kanban in circulation is controlled by some regulatory function that enforces its value. That is, a kanban is a kind of private currency and the shop floor manager is the bank that issues it, for the purpose of economic calculation. Teamly gives you the functionality needed to manage your entire team, remotely.
One of these solutions is the fusion of these three agile systems, known as “scrumban.” Although agile hybrids come with their share of controversy, scrumban certainly has its advocates. Despite the various advantages of Scrumban, there are some drawbacks of adopting this methodology in practice. Being a relatively new agile methodology there are no defined best practices for using Scrumban. A final drawback of Scrumban is that it is not the easiest project workflow system to monitor and manage at all the steps, and that stakeholders may not see the order going on inside the chaos. Scrumban is great at producing deliverables through its iterative work process and short sprints of activity. Well, you could say the Scrumban board begins where the Kanban board left off.
The roles include the scrum master, the product owner, and the development team. Long-term money saving – What happens when a project’s goal is missed, or the final product falls short of expectations? Yes, our software removes one of the disadvantages of scrumban. There might be no daily stand-up meetings, but project managers can generate reports with one click to monitor progress on tasks, project variance, health and more. The reports can be filtered to customize them to show just the data you want. The Kanban method also helps scrumban by limiting how many items are in progress at any time, which increases focus on specific tasks and helps productivity.
The team wants to incrementally improve the final product during the sprint and then showcase it to the stakeholders at the release. Scrumban is an Agile methodology that aids team members in more effective project management. It was initially employed as a transitional Scrumban methodology. However, Scrumban eventually gained traction with team members and emerged as a stand-alone technique.
There is no established setup for assigning tasks and no progress tracking system which can make planning harder. Team members are free from the confines of roles and can select their tasks without much involvement from the manager. Additionally, they don’t have to worry about daily standups and other reports which creates a relaxing work environment.